
Qualified Aussie Specialists are invited to Tourism Australia’s international familiarization and workshop event, G’day Australia, which will be held in Cairns from 09-12OCT, bringing together 300 travel agents from around the world to learn about Australia’s tourism offerings first-hand and to network with industry peers.
Qualified agents who have completed Tourism Australia’s online training program will have the opportunity to meet with Australian sellers in Cairns and participate in pre and post-event FAMs around the country.
Tourism Australia Managing Director, Phillipa Harrison, said G’day Australia is an important event for Aussie Specialists agents, who are the frontline travel sellers that actively sell Australia as a preferred long-haul destination and will be critical as the travel industry continues its recovery from the global COVID-19 pandemic.
“Our Aussie Specialists agents know so much about our country from the Aussie Specialist Program, but we know being on the ground in Australia, meeting our amazing tourism operators and experiencing what they do provides even more inspiration to confidently sell Australia to clients,” Harrison said.
“The event, to be held in October this year, will provide a great opportunity to highlight what’s on offer in Tropical North Queensland, which has long been a destination popular with international visitors as its offerings stretch from rainforests, to beaches, to the Great Barrier Reef and so much more."
Tourism and Events Queensland CEO Patricia O’Callaghan said, “Rebuilding Queensland’s $6 billion international market is critical to the future of tourism for this country and we have been working hard to do this."
She added, “Queensland is a bucket list destination, and our comprehensive familiarization program will run right around the state showing everything from the reef to the rainforest, the ocean to the Outback and of course our iconic beaches."
G’day Australia will take place in the same format to the Corroboree events held annually before the global COVID-19 pandemic. Corroboree was held for Asia and Western markets in alternate years, while this year’s G’day Australia event will be global, covering all key international markets.
To apply, Qualified Aussie Specialists must complete their ‘Introduction to Australia’ curriculum and ‘Queensland Training Course’ before submitting their application.
Applications are due by 17MAY, 2023.
